There are big questions all of us
face. What happens when
I die? Where will I spend eternity? The single most important
question that you will ever answer is this - “If I were to die
today, would I spend eternity in Heaven with God?” Your
relationship to Jesus Christ is central to the answer.
The Bible tells us in I John 5:13, “I
write these things to you who believe in the name of the Son of
God so that you may know that you have eternal
life.” (emphasis added) The
simple truth is God wants you to know where you're going! So,
here it is in a nutshell:
- First, you must understand your need. The Bible is very clear that we all
have a huge problem called sin. Romans 3:23 says it this
way, “for all have sinned and fall short of the glory of
God,” This verse simply means that none of us are perfect.
Are you willing to admit that?
- The problem is this - sin has a high
price tag. Romans 6:23a says, “For the wages of sin is death ...” In other words, the price for sin is
spiritual death
and separation from God in a place called Hell - not a good thing!
Because of our sin, none of us can make it into Heaven
in our own effort.
- Here's the good news - God sent help,
a Savior!
The rest of Romans 6:23 says, “... but the gift of God is
eternal life in Christ Jesus our Lord.” Again in Romans 5:8
God says, “But God demonstrates his own love for us in this:
While we were still sinners, Christ died for us.” This leads us
to the next step.
- You must believe that Jesus Christ wants to be
your Savior! Jesus Christ came to earth as God in
the flesh, lived a perfect life, and then voluntarily died
on a cross because He loves you. On that cross, He literally
paid for all of your sins. He took your blame! He punished
Himself for our wrong-doings. What an incredible gift!
- John 3:16 says, “For
God so loved the world that he gave his one and only Son,
that whoever believes in him shall not perish but have
eternal life.” God, in His awesome love, came to earth to make a way
for you to be forgiven of your sins and given eternal life!
- Finally, you must place your full trust
in Jesus Christ as your personal Savior. Romans 10:13 says,
“for, 'Everyone who calls on the name of the Lord will be
saved.'” In verse 10 of that same chapter God says, “For it
is with your heart that you believe and are justified, and
it is with your mouth that you confess and are saved.” He says it's
as simple as believing, confessing and receiving!
